Transaction ead2824636beb1096cd6b3f02be963f9bde8c19d7961c35d54deda417f78912b
1 Input
1 Output
-
ead2824636beb1096cd6b3f02be963f9bde8c19d7961c35d54deda417f78912b:0
- value
- 501706
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3158de50e63132a3e8ebc2ab18d14777e85ad30d OP_EQUAL
- address
- 36BwVdUPm9hkvdUjSdYtrNinuqYeyGfE1X